Web3 mei 2024 · The testing, therefore, looks for a reading from the wrist strap system of less than 3.5 x 10 7 (35,000,000) ohms, and a reading from the foot grounder of less than 1 x 10 9 ohms (1 gigohm). Since wrist straps and foot grounders are regularly flexed testing their electrical resistance regularly is encouraged. Web12 apr. 2024 · A low frequency, low noise amplifier board You may not know this, but using a spectrum analyzer to directly measure that 50 ohms thermal noise isn’t really doable as even top of the line Rohde & Schwarz FSWs state a Displayed Averaged Noise Level (in short, an instrument’s noise floor ) between 71nV and 224nV RMS (-130dBm & … WebZero ohm reading in an ohmmeter suggests zero resistance between the testing points. But in most cases, the test leads of the ohmmeter have a very small amount of resistance. Generally, any resistance value less than 1 ohm is considered as zero. Zero ohm in a digital multimeter means there is continuity in the circuit. top 10 games to play on laptop
